Bottega Veneta Fabric Development Intern
Bottega Veneta, a distinguished name in luxury fashion, has been inspiring individuality with its innovative craftsmanship since 1966. Originating from Vicenza, the brand is deeply rooted in Italian culture while maintaining a global perspective. As part of the Kering Group, a global luxury conglomerate, Bottega Veneta offers a unique blend of inclusivity and exclusivity, providing an enriching environment for professional growth and development.
- Assist the Fabric Development team with daily tasks.
- Create and update fabric cards, ensuring consistent information maintenance.
- Compile archive books of fabric references at the end of each season.
- Receive and unpack fabric packages and rolls.
- Manage and monitor shipments.
- Maintain a clean and organized fabric archive.
- Support fabric sourcing and facilitate communication between Product Development and Design offices.
- Currently enrolled in a Fashion Design or Textiles program, with a focus on Textile or Ready-To-Wear preferred.
- Demonstrated aesthetic sensibility and product knowledge with a passion for fashion.
-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
- Detail-oriented, dynamic, and proactive.
- Excellent teamwork and interpersonal skills.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, including Excel and PowerPoint.
- Knowledge of Adobe Creative Suite, including Photoshop and Illustrator.
- Fluency in English; proficiency in Italian is advantageous.
